Ingredients
2 to 3 beets
juice and zest of 1 lemon
2 garlic cloves, minced
½ cup apple cider vinegar
2 tablespoons maple syrup
3 tablespoons olive oil
1 teaspoon sea salt
½ teaspoon pepper
Optional Ingredients
fresh herbs, for garnish
Directions
Wash the beets, and cut off the root end.
Place them in a large pot with water to cover by at least 3 inches, and turn the heat on high. Bring to a boil, then lower to medium-high and cook for 30 minutes to 1 hour. This really depends on the size of your beats. (Very large ones will likely take 1 hour.) They are done when you can easily stick a knife or toothpick in.
While the beets are cooking, zest the lemon, and set aside. Combine the juice from the lemon with the minced garlic cloves, vinegar, maple syrup, olive oil, sea salt, and pepper. Whisk to combine.
When the beets are tender, rinse under cold water. Wearing gloves (so your hands don't get stained), peel the beets and cut into slices about ½-inch thick.
Put in a container, and pour the dressing in to coat all the pieces. Let this sit for at least 30 minutes to 1 hour.
When done marinating, put the beets on a medium-high heat grill, and cook for about 5 minutes on each side. If your beets are small, you won't need to cook as long.
When they are done, put the cooked beets on a serving tray, add the lemon zest and any fresh herbs, if desired.
